Applied StemCell will be presenting our newest technology at the TT2017: The 14th Transgenic Technology Meeting to be held in Salt Lake City Utah from October 1-4, 2017. We will be showcasing novel transgenic rat and mouse models for advanced biomedical research using our proprietary gene editing technology, Our highlight of this year's poster presentation is a $1.3M USD grant from the NIH to establish a Cre rat line repository for the generation of complex and advanced transgenic rat model. ASC proposes to build this repository using its proprietary TARGATT™ technology for generating twenty-one Cre rat lines for researchers' use.
